Analystreport

Vale SA (NYSE: VALE) had its "hold" rating re-affirmed by analysts at Royal Bank of Canada.

VALE S.A. American Depositary Shares Each Representing one common share  (VALE) 
Last vale s.a. american depositary shares each representing one common share earnings: 4/29 04:02 pm Check Earnings Report
US:NYSE Investor Relations: vale.com/en/investors/pages/default.aspx